Comparing enrollment methods

Method Best for Learner experience TA effort
Manual enrollment Small groups or one-off learner additions Learners are added by the TA Higher for large groups
CSV enrollment Large groups going into one learning plan Learners are added by the TA through a file upload Lower for large groups
Self-registration Learner-driven enrollment or open enrollment campaigns Learners use a link to register or enroll themselves Lower after setup
Group enrollment Different populations that need different learning plans Learners are added based on group membership Higher setup, easier reuse

Tip: If you are choosing between CSV enrollment and group enrollment, use CSV enrollment for one learning plan and group enrollment when different populations need different learning plans.

Choosing manual enrollment

Manual enrollment is best when you only need to enroll a small number of existing learners, groups, or a branch.

Use manual enrollment when… Use something else when…
  • you are adding a small number of learners
  • you are enrolling one group or branch
  • you want to confirm each selection manually
  • you have a long spreadsheet of learners
  • learners should enroll themselves
  • different learner populations need different learning plans

Choosing CSV enrollment

CSV enrollment is best when you already have learners in a spreadsheet and need to enroll many users into the same learning plan.

Use CSV enrollment when… Use something else when…
  • many learners need the same learning plan
  • you already have a CSV file
  • you want a TA-controlled enrollment process
  • learners should decide whether to enroll
  • different learner populations need different learning plans
  • you only need to add one or two learners

Choosing self-registration

Self-registration is best when learners should use a link to register for or enroll in a learning plan themselves.

Important: Learners will not be able to self-register or enroll in a learning plan unless the learning plan is published.

Use self-registration when… Use something else when…
  • learners should enroll themselves
  • you are sending a launch email with a link
  • you do not need to pre-select every learner
  • you need to control exactly who is enrolled
  • learners should be enrolled before the launch message goes out
  • you need to enroll a defined list from a spreadsheet

Choosing group enrollment

Group enrollment is best when several distinct learning populations need different learning plans.

Important: Users must exist in the system before they can be added to a group.

Use group enrollment when… Use something else when…
  • different populations need different learning plans
  • you want to reuse a learner population later
  • you want to enroll a group instead of selecting learners one by one
  • everyone in the file needs the same learning plan
  • you do not need to reuse the population
  • you only have a small number of learners
